在搭建Windows数据科学环境时,选择合适的运行库和工具是关键。Python作为主流语言,其包管理工具pip和conda提供了丰富的依赖管理功能,能够有效减少版本冲突问题。
推荐使用Anaconda作为基础环境,它集成了Python、Jupyter Notebook以及大量科学计算库,简化了安装流程。通过conda create命令可以快速创建独立的虚拟环境,避免全局环境的混乱。
安装过程中应优先考虑版本兼容性。例如,TensorFlow和PyTorch对Python版本有特定要求,需在官网确认对应版本后再进行安装。同时,建议定期更新pip和conda,以获取最新的安全补丁和功能改进。

本图基于AI算法,仅供参考
对于需要高性能计算的场景,可考虑安装CUDA和cuDNN以支持GPU加速。这通常涉及下载驱动程序并配置环境变量,确保深度学习框架能正确识别硬件资源。
为提升效率,可使用虚拟环境管理工具如virtualenv或conda env,实现不同项目间的隔离。•记录环境配置的requirements.txt文件有助于后续快速重建环境。
•保持系统整洁,定期清理无用的包和旧版本,可以避免潜在的依赖冲突,提高整体运行稳定性。